Output a5bfbede9a67eeae3b703ea1f9e9097e1d4a92cb86bb65920de89cfba3f98173:15

value
9000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abcf581c1268925286e165dcad09812c2a3a906a OP_EQUAL
address
3HMTrsaTJtYqLuF7ZaoyZNoM6RvEueY3US
transaction
a5bfbede9a67eeae3b703ea1f9e9097e1d4a92cb86bb65920de89cfba3f98173
confirmations
498646
spent
true